Whole Foods Shops Around For Sustainable Refrigeration System
When it comes to the use of natural refrigerants in commercial refrigeration, Whole Foods Market (WFM) is a pioneer. Even before the recent wave of regulations, WFM was deploying sustainable refrigeration systems with the intent of reducing environmental impacts and improving efficiencies. Today, 22 of its 465 stores utilize all-natural refrigerant systems, with most of them moving to the hydrocarbon R-290 (propane) for their self-contained cases.
WFM’s director of sustainability and facilities for its Northern California region, Tristam Coffin, has been dedicated to fulfilling the company’s green refrigeration vision.
